Hardee County and Taylor County are counties in Florida.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.

Hardee County has the higher population (25,508 vs 21,422 in Taylor County). Hardee County has the higher median household income ($54,231 vs $44,985 in Taylor County). Hardee County has the higher median home value ($129,400 vs $100,200 in Taylor County).
